Introduction: Understanding Percentages

A percentage is a way of expressing a number as a fraction of 100. In practice, the term "percent" is derived from the Latin "per centum," meaning "out of a hundred. " Because of this, 1% represents one part out of a hundred equal parts, 50% represents fifty parts out of a hundred, and so on. Converting fractions to percentages involves finding the equivalent fraction with a denominator of 100, or employing a simple mathematical formula.

Method 1: Converting the Fraction to an Equivalent Fraction with a Denominator of 100

The most straightforward approach to determining 37/50 as a percentage is to find an equivalent fraction with a denominator of 100. To do this, we ask ourselves: "What number, when multiplied by 50, equals 100?" The answer is 2.

Since we multiply the denominator by 2, we must also multiply the numerator by 2 to maintain the fraction's value:

37/50 * 2/2 = 74/100

Method 2: Using the Percentage Formula

Another method to convert a fraction to a percentage involves using the following formula:

Percentage = (Numerator / Denominator) * 100%

Let's apply this formula to our fraction, 37/50:

Percentage = (37 / 50) * 100% = 0.74 * 100% = 74%

Method 3: Using Decimal Conversion

First, we convert the fraction 37/50 into a decimal by dividing the numerator (37) by the denominator (50):

37 ÷ 50 = 0.74

Then, we multiply the decimal by 100% to express it as a percentage:

0.74 * 100% = 74%

Illustrative Examples: Applying Percentage Calculations in Real-World Scenarios

Let's consider some real-world examples to illustrate the practical application of converting fractions to percentages, specifically using 37/50 as a percentage:

  • Academic Performance: Imagine a student scored 37 out of 50 marks on a test. Their percentage score would be 74%, calculated as (37/50) * 100% = 74%. This provides a clear and easily understandable representation of their performance.

  • Percentage Increase/Decrease: Percentages are crucial in calculating percentage increases or decreases. Take this: if a value increases from 50 to 74, the percentage increase is calculated as [(74-50)/50] * 100% = 48%.
